Output d1cdf72c90bf766f3e9b55a3f09dace7ae4f0ca62001e97f78d81ffda07b2e89:1

value
4066732868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19e1d76258cb60c137e9f65c57446759fcc982bc OP_EQUAL
address
2Muc5Rp1rkyKLbKMRnfqVz4xXscxykMYk7i
transaction
d1cdf72c90bf766f3e9b55a3f09dace7ae4f0ca62001e97f78d81ffda07b2e89